Pictures: "Extinct" Monkeys With Sideburns Found in Borneo

Friday, January 20, 2012 - 19:30 in Biology & Nature

The Miller's grizzled langur, a rare monkey species with bristly sideburns, has been "rediscovered" in a forest in northeastern Borneo, a new study says.
